Al-Ittifaq’s fans on social media considered Tunisian professional Naeem Al-Saliti’s absence from Al-Ittifa’s team even after three rounds of Saudi League Roshan a convoluted mystery.
Some of these fans demanded that the player’s contract be terminated if his absence lasted longer, and that he be replaced, if possible, with another foreign professional.
Al-Saliti has not appeared with an agreement since the launch of the current version of the Saudi league Roshan, after the player was injured and the club has not yet announced a date for his return to the team’s group training.
It should be noted that “Al-Ettifak” is preparing these days for the match of the third round against “Labatin” in Dammam.
Macedonian defender Darko Vilkovski, who recently joined the deal, has embarked on group training to be available in the Al Bateen match while Asteroid undergoes remedial exercises after it was confirmed he had a muscle strain and his fate in the match of the third round has not yet been determined.
